Downtown Ames blends historic character with a forward-looking pulse, where indie shops, public art, and friendly sidewalks make everyday errands feel like an outing. On Main Street, the district’s heartbeat, you’ll find community festivals, gallery hops, and street-side patios curated by the team at Ames Main Street, while the Octagon Center for the Arts anchors the creative scene with exhibitions, classes, and an annual arts festival. Book lovers gravitate to the bright, modern Ames Public Library, and Saturday mornings fill with fresh finds at the farmers’ market.
Families appreciate the strong academics in the Ames Community School District and the quick connections to the new Ames High School campus. Living here means easy access to the Iowa State University campus and the energy of nearby Campustown, plus a short stroll to green spaces like Bandshell and Brookside parks. Getting around is simple with CyRide, which links Downtown to neighborhoods and campus with frequent service.
Housing ranges from upstairs lofts in century-old buildings to updated condos and townhomes, giving buyers and renters flexible options in the center of Ames. Weeknights can be as mellow or as social as you like, whether it’s catching a live set, exploring a new tasting room, or joining a community workshop.
